also sprach Eric Blake <address@hidden> [2006.07.12.1418 +0200]:
> There is also flipdiff, part of the patchutils package, which can reverse
> a diff that you generated in the wrong direction.
From the manpage:
flipdiff exchanges the order of two patch files that apply one
after the other.
I also looked at flipdiff first, but it didn't seem to do the deed.
It'd be easy to write a little script to reverse a diff though, but
I don't see why this option cannot be in the diff binary, given that
patch also has -R.
